Maryland -13.5 over Rutgers ****
Both teams were blown away last week...Nites coach Ash fired with off coord just like I said would happen...RU qb is still the worst qb in the country and even though his stats looked good he only passed to his backs for short yardage..Carter is still out with concussion problems..how does Rutgers respond to Ash firing.. he was well liked but was over his head from the start...to me its makes no difference how the team responds..they still have no pass rush, no tight end,wr's that get no separation,OL that is below avg and a qb who is a pocket passer and not accurate..in lasts game vs Maryland Sit was 2-16 for 8yds and 4 interceptions ..thereonly real stength is Blackshear at halfback and Pacheco ..so teams can stack the box and Rutgers can't get any 1st downs... Terps have Jackson at qb..he has been inconsistent but he should have all the time in the world today...they did beat Cuse 63-20 but then lost to Penn St 59-0...terps do have a few rb's in McFarland and Leake and some decent wr's in Demus and Jones..they have 12 rushing td's and Rutgers defense can't stop anybody...look for Terps to take out there 59-0 Penn St blowout on Rutgers..new coach isn't helping this team Rutgers team...

Tough game to handicap..both teams run options one runs from a spread the other from the wish ...tulane has some speed and Army has won 15 straight at home .. Army's qb is starting but Hopkins is banged up...Army has not played its A game except vs Michigan...but they won big over Morgan St last week but but really struggled..they have had 8 turnovers already and watching them beat Rice 14-7 at home shows me this isn't the same team as last yr.. Tulane has some speed and can score...both coach come from Ga southern where they learned the option..think Willie Fritz the wave coach knows the wishbone and can coach against it...Tulane played Auburn tough but gave up over 500 yds to Houston McMillan is a sold qb who can run and pass...think he gives Army some problems and the Wave pull out a rare win at the Point..
